More about the book
The story follows an 82-year-old woman, the glamorous daughter of a notorious New Jersey mobster, as she confronts her past after a lifetime of denial. Returning to her hometown, she discovers a world transformed and must navigate the complexities of her legacy. This poignant narrative explores themes of identity, family, and the impact of one's roots, appealing to fans of literary fiction.
